Understanding OKX Wallet

OKX Wallet is a non-custodial cryptocurrency wallet, meaning only you control your private keys and funds. It supports a wide range of digital assets including Bitcoin, Ethereum, stablecoins, and NFTs across multiple networks like Ethereum, Binance Smart Chain, Solana, and more. With built-in access to DeFi dApps, swap features, staking opportunities, and NFT marketplaces, OKX Wallet serves as a comprehensive gateway into the Web3 ecosystem.

Whether you're a beginner just starting out or an experienced crypto user switching platforms, OKX Wallet makes it simple to either create a new wallet or import an existing one via seed phrase or private key.

How to Create or Import a Wallet on Mobile App

Step 1: Download and Open the OKX App

Start by downloading the official OKX app from the App Store (iOS) or Google Play Store (Android). Once installed, open the app and navigate to the Web3 Wallet section.

Step 2: Choose “Create Wallet”

Tap on Create Wallet, then set a strong password that you’ll use to access your wallet within the app. This password does not recover your wallet—it only unlocks it locally on your device.

Step 3: Back Up Your Recovery Phrase

After creating your wallet, you’ll be shown a 12-word recovery (or seed) phrase. This is the most important part of the setup:

This phrase is the only way to recover your wallet if you lose access to your device.

Step 4: Confirm Your Recovery Phrase

You’ll be asked to re-enter the words in order to confirm you've backed them up correctly.

Once confirmed, your wallet is ready to use. You can now receive crypto, explore dApps, swap tokens, and participate in Web3 activities.

Want to Import an Existing Wallet?

If you already have a wallet (e.g., MetaMask, Trust Wallet), you can import it into OKX Wallet:

  1. Instead of selecting “Create Wallet,” choose Import Wallet.
  2. Enter your 12-word recovery phrase or private key.
  3. Set a password for local access.
  4. Your imported wallet will appear with all supported assets visible.
⚠️ Security Tip: Always double-check that you're using the official OKX app. Never enter your recovery phrase on phishing websites or suspicious apps.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Is OKX Wallet free to use?
A: Yes, downloading and using OKX Wallet is completely free. There are no subscription fees or hidden charges. However, standard blockchain network fees (gas fees) apply when sending transactions.

Q: Can I use my OKX exchange account to log in?
A: No. OKX Wallet is separate from your exchange account. It’s a self-custody wallet where you control your keys—not linked to any centralized login.

Q: What should I do if I lose my recovery phrase?
A: Unfortunately, there is no way to recover your wallet without the recovery phrase. OKX does not store your data. Always keep your seed phrase safe and never share it.

Q: Can I import my MetaMask wallet into OKX Wallet?
A: Yes. Since both are Ethereum-compatible wallets using BIP39 standard seed phrases, you can easily import your MetaMask wallet into OKX Wallet using the same 12-word recovery phrase.

Q: Is OKX Wallet safe?
A: Yes—OKX Wallet uses industry-standard encryption and is non-custodial, meaning only you have access to your private keys. As long as you protect your recovery phrase and device, your funds remain secure.

Q: Does OKX Wallet support hardware wallets?
A: Yes. You can connect popular hardware wallets like Ledger or Trezor to OKX Wallet for added security when signing transactions.
